#6b6c4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b6c4d is composed of 42% red, 42.4%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.7%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 61.9 degrees, a saturation of 16.8% and a lightness of 36.3%. #6b6c4d color hex could be obtained by blending #d6d89a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#6b6c4d color description : Very dark grayish yellow.
#6b6c4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b6c4d has RGB values of R:107, G:108,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7040077.
